A recipe I've used for repairing the plastic portion of the panel is to freeze a scrap panel and grind it into almost a dust. (Don't tell my wife I used the food processor) Prepare your mating pieces or whatever you are trying to bond together by cleaning with some solvent. Then, mix the grey dust with Testors model glue and make a paste and quickly apply it to the areas that you are repairing. Then I take an aluminum mesh ( Hobby Lobby has it ) and form it to the area that is being repaired and slather the mesh with the grey paste......better wear gloves. I'll drizzle straight Testors on the joint as well during this. Then, point a light at it and don't breathe too deep nearby.
